Maintenance fixed bolster of motor maintenance usefulness
Technical Field
The utility model belongs to the technical field of motors, and particularly relates to a maintenance fixing support for motor maintenance.
Background
The motor is an electromagnetic device for realizing electric energy conversion or transmission according to an electromagnetic induction law. The motor is represented by a letter M (old standard is represented by a letter D) in a circuit, the motor mainly plays a role of generating driving torque and serving as a power source of electrical appliances or various machines, the generator is represented by a letter G in a circuit, and the generator mainly plays a role of converting mechanical energy into electric energy.
Along with the development of the mechanical industry, the use of the motor is more and more extensive, and the motor is easy to be damaged after being used for a long time, so that the motor needs to be maintained, and the general maintenance is placed on the ground, so that maintenance personnel need to bend down for maintenance, and the maintenance effect is influenced.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ments. All other embodiments, which can be derived by a person skilled in the art from the embodiments given herein without making any creative effort, shall fall within the protection scope of the present invention.
Referring to fig. 1-6, the present invention provides the following technical solutions: a maintenance fixing support for motor maintenance comprises a support box 1, two sides of the support box 1 are respectively provided with a movable box 10, the interior of the movable box 10 is provided with a moving device, the periphery of the bottom of the support box 1 is respectively provided with an anti-skid base 17, the interior of the support box 1 is respectively provided with a storage device, one end of the interior of the support box 1 is provided with a motor 24, the output end of the motor 24 is provided with a third rotating shaft 33, one end of the third rotating shaft 33 is provided with a fourth gear 34, the surface of the fourth gear 34 is provided with a first chain 25, one end of the interior of the first chain 25 is provided with a third gear 31, the interior of the third gear 31 is provided with a second rotating shaft 32, the surface of one end of the second rotating shaft 32 is provided with a first gear 26, the surface of the first gear 26 is provided with a second chain 30, one end of the interior of the second chain 30 is provided with a second gear 28, the interior of the second gear 28 is provided with a first rotating shaft 29, the second rotating shaft 32 and the first rotating shaft 29 are both provided with a second sleeve 9, the second sleeve 9 is provided with a second inner rod 8 inside, the top of the second inner rod 8 is provided with a placing rack 7, two ends of the placing rack 7 are provided with clamping devices, two sides of the placing rack 7 are respectively provided with a first inner rod 3, the bottom of the first inner rod 3 is provided with a first sleeve 2, through the arrangement, the motor 24 works, so that the motor 24 drives the fourth gear 34 to rotate through the third rotating shaft 33, the fourth gear 34 drives the third gear 31 to rotate through the first chain 25, so that the third gear 31 drives the second chain 30 to rotate through the first gear 26, the second chain 30 drives the first rotating shaft 29 to rotate through the second gear 28, so that the second rotating shaft 32 and the first rotating shaft 29 drive the second sleeve 9 to rotate, and the second sleeve 9 drives the second inner rod 8 to move through threads, make the interior pole of second 8 drive rack 7 and reciprocate to adjust the height of rack 7, make rack 7 adjust the position of suitable maintenance workman's operation, thereby increase the convenience of maintenance, reduce unnecessary trouble, and set up first sleeve 2 and interior pole 3, be for restricting rack 7, prevent that rack 7 from taking place to rock when removing.
Specifically, clamping device is including threaded rod 5, and the one end of threaded rod 5 is provided with handle 4, and the other end of threaded rod 5 is provided with clamp splice 6, and when the inside of rack 7 was placed to the motor, through turning handle 4, make handle 4 drive clamp splice 6 through threaded rod 5 and remove to make clamp splice 6 fix the motor, prevent that the motor from taking place to slide when the maintenance, thereby the effect that leads to the maintenance receives the influence.
Specifically, strorage device is including drawer box 12, one side of drawer box 12 is provided with handle 11, the bottom of drawer box 12 is provided with slider 13 respectively, spout 27 has been seted up respectively to the inner wall of supporting box 1, and slider 13 and spout 27 sliding connection, when some maintenance tools are placed to needs, through pulling handle 11, make handle 11 drive drawer box 12 through slider 13 and remove in spout 27's inside, thereby put into the inside of drawer box 12 with the instrument and deposit, prevent that the instrument from losing, increase the security of instrument.
Specifically, the inside that the one end of handle 11 extended to drawer box 12 is provided with turning block 16, one side of turning block 16 is provided with round pin piece 14, round pin piece 14's surface is provided with solid fixed ring 15, the round pin groove has been seted up at the top of supporting box 1 inner wall, through rotating handle 11, make handle 11 drive turning block 16 rotate, thereby make turning block 16 drive round pin piece 14 rebound, make round pin piece 14 remove the inside in round pin groove, thereby fix drawer box 12, prevent drawer box 12 from the inside roll-off of supporting box 1 when removing, protect drawer box 12.
Specifically, the mobile device is including hydraulic pump 20, hydraulic pump 20's output is provided with hydraulic stem 23, the one end of hydraulic stem 23 is provided with connecting plate 18, the both ends of connecting plate 18 bottom are provided with wheel 19 respectively, work through the hydraulic pump 20 that sets up, make hydraulic pump 20 drive connecting plate 18 through hydraulic stem 23 and move down, thereby make connecting plate 18 drive wheel 19 and move down, make wheel 19 move below this equipment, then make this equipment move through wheel 19, thereby increase the mobility of this equipment, make the position that needs work that the removal that this equipment can be better moved.
Specifically, the two ends of the top of the connecting plate 18 are respectively provided with a third inner rod 22, the top of the third inner rod 22 is provided with a third sleeve 21, and the third inner rod 22 and the third sleeve 21 are arranged to limit the connecting plate 18, so that the connecting plate 18 is prevented from shaking when moving downwards, and the moving effect is influenced.
The working principle and the using process of the utility model are as follows: after the utility model is installed, when the motor is placed in the placing rack 7, the handle 4 drives the clamping block 6 to move through the threaded rod 5, so that the clamping block 6 fixes the motor, the motor 24 drives the fourth gear 34 to rotate through the third rotating shaft 33, the fourth gear 34 drives the third gear 31 to rotate through the first chain 25, so that the third gear 31 drives the second chain 30 to rotate through the first gear 26, the second chain 30 drives the first rotating shaft 29 to rotate through the second gear 28, thereby make second axis of rotation 32 and first axis of rotation 29 drive second sleeve 9 and rotate, make second sleeve 9 drive the interior pole of second 8 through the screw thread and reciprocate, adjust the height of rack 7, make rack 7 adjust the position of suitable maintenance workman's operation, all consumer all supply power through external power supply in this device.
